标签: javascript performance
我计划使用数据属性来识别DOM中的元素以用于硒测试用例。属性的使用是否会影响应用程序性能?
答案 0 :(得分:4)
完全没有,你可以使用data-*属性。但是,您应该注意,使用语法$.data(theInput, 'someData');要比使用语法theInput.data('someData');快得多,如此jsPerf中所示。
data-*
$.data(theInput, 'someData');
theInput.data('someData');